Commit Message

Jacopo Mondi March 20, 2019, 4:30 p.m. UTC
As the lenghty comment reports, link enable/disable is not trivial, as
links in one ImgU instance interfere with capture operations in the
other one. As I struggle to find where to disable links selectively,
as of now reset the media graph and enable the required links at
streamConfiguration time.

Signed-off-by: Jacopo Mondi <jacopo@jmondi.org>
---
 src/libcamera/pipeline/ipu3/ipu3.cpp | 110 +++++++++++++++++++++++++++
 1 file changed, 110 insertions(+)

Laurent Pinchart March 23, 2019, 1:09 p.m. UTC | #1
Hi Jacopo,

Thank you for the patch.

On Wed, Mar 20, 2019 at 05:30:39PM +0100, Jacopo Mondi wrote:
> As the lenghty comment reports, link enable/disable is not trivial, as
> links in one ImgU instance interfere with capture operations in the
> other one. As I struggle to find where to disable links selectively,
> as of now reset the media graph and enable the required links at
> streamConfiguration time.

Do we need this additional complexity ? Given that we currently have to
link all but the params video nodes, couldn't you just disable the
params link and enable all the other ones at match time, without
touching links when configuring the streams ?

Jacopo Mondi March 23, 2019, 1:51 p.m. UTC | #2
Hi Laurent,

On Sat, Mar 23, 2019 at 03:09:34PM +0200, Laurent Pinchart wrote:
> Hi Jacopo,
>
> Thank you for the patch.
>
> On Wed, Mar 20, 2019 at 05:30:39PM +0100, Jacopo Mondi wrote:
> > As the lenghty comment reports, link enable/disable is not trivial, as
> > links in one ImgU instance interfere with capture operations in the
> > other one. As I struggle to find where to disable links selectively,
> > as of now reset the media graph and enable the required links at
> > streamConfiguration time.
>
> Do we need this additional complexity ? Given that we currently have to
> link all but the params video nodes, couldn't you just disable the
> params link and enable all the other ones at match time, without
> touching links when configuring the streams ?

Enable links on both the ImgU instances you mean?

As I tried to explain in the comment, this is not really possible,
because if you enable links on the ImgU instance, the system expects
frames to be queued to its input, otherwise the processing on the the
other instance, which is in use, stall.

This can be easily triggered by enabling links on imgu1 in the
ipu3-process.sh script, which uses imgu0.

Patch

diff --git a/src/libcamera/pipeline/ipu3/ipu3.cpp b/src/libcamera/pipeline/ipu3/ipu3.cpp
index ed2409907cf0..43fa0e4a7f9d 100644
--- a/src/libcamera/pipeline/ipu3/ipu3.cpp
+++ b/src/libcamera/pipeline/ipu3/ipu3.cpp
@@ -52,6 +52,10 @@  public:
 	}
 
 	void init(MediaDevice *media, unsigned int index);
+	int linkSetup(const std::string &source, unsigned int sourcePad,
+		      const std::string &sink, unsigned int sinkPad,
+		      bool enable);
+	int enableLinks(bool enable);
 
 	unsigned int index_;
 	std::string imguName_;
@@ -264,6 +268,14 @@  int PipelineHandlerIPU3::configureStreams(Camera *camera,
 		return -EINVAL;
 	}
 
+	/*
+	 * \todo: Enable links selectively based on the requested streams.
+	 * As of now, enable all links unconditionally.
+	 */
+	ret = data->imgu->enableLinks(true);
+	if (ret)
+		return ret;
+
 	/*
 	 * Pass the requested output image size to the sensor and get back the
 	 * adjusted one to be propagated to the CIO2 device and to the ImgU
@@ -589,6 +601,30 @@  bool PipelineHandlerIPU3::match(DeviceEnumerator *enumerator)
 		return false;
 	}
 
+	/*
+	 * FIXME: enabled links in one ImgU instance interfere with capture
+	 * operations on the other one. This can be easily triggered by
+	 * capturing from one camera and then trying to capture from the other
+	 * one right after, without disabling media links in the media graph
+	 * first.
+	 *
+	 * The tricky part here is where to disable links on the ImgU instance
+	 * which is currently not in use:
+	 * 1) Link enable/disable cannot be done at start/stop time as video
+	 * devices needs to be linked first before format can be configured on
+	 * them.
+	 * 2) As link enable has to be done at the least in configureStreams,
+	 * before configuring formats, the only place where to disable links
+	 * would be 'stop()', but the Camera class state machine allows
+	 * start()<->stop() sequences without any streamConfiguration() in
+	 * between.
+	 *
+	 * As of now, disable all links in the media graph at 'match()' time,
+	 * to allow testing different cameras in different test applications
+	 * runs. A test application that would use two distinct cameras without
+	 * going through a library teardown->match() sequence would fail
+	 * at the moment.
+	 */
 	if (imguMediaDev_->disableLinks())
 		goto error_close_mdev;
 
@@ -625,6 +661,80 @@  void ImgUDevice::init(MediaDevice *mediaDevice, unsigned int index)
 	mediaDevice_ = mediaDevice;
 }
 
+/**
+ * \brief Enable or disable a single link on the ImgU instance
+ *
+ * This method assumes the media device associated with the ImgU instance
+ * is open.
+ *
+ * \return 0 on success or a negative error code otherwise
+ */
+int ImgUDevice::linkSetup(const std::string &source, unsigned int sourcePad,
+			  const std::string &sink, unsigned int sinkPad,
+			  bool enable)
+{
+	MediaLink *link = mediaDevice_->link(source, sourcePad, sink, sinkPad);
+	if (!link) {
+		LOG(IPU3, Error)
+			<< "Failed to get link: '" << source << "':"
+			<< sourcePad << " -> '" << sink << "':" << sinkPad;
+		return -ENODEV;
+	}
+
+	return link->setEnabled(enable);
+}
+
+/**
+ * \brief Enable or disable all media links in the ImgU instance to prepare
+ * for capture operations
+ *
+ * \todo This method will probably be removed or changed once links will be
+ * enabled or disabled selectively.
+ *
+ * \return 0 on success or a negative error code otherwise
+ */
+int ImgUDevice::enableLinks(bool enable)
+{
+	std::string inputName = imguName_ + " input";
+	std::string outputName = imguName_ + " output";
+	std::string viewfinderName = imguName_ + " viewfinder";
+	std::string statName = imguName_ + " 3a stat";
+	int ret;
+
+	/* \todo Establish rules to handle media devices open/close. */
+	ret = mediaDevice_->open();
+	if (ret)
+		return ret;
+
+	ret = linkSetup(inputName, 0, imguName_, PAD_INPUT, enable);
+	if (ret) {
+		mediaDevice_->close();
+		return ret;
+	}
+
+	ret = linkSetup(imguName_, PAD_OUTPUT, outputName, 0, enable);
+	if (ret) {
+		mediaDevice_->close();
+		return ret;
+	}
+
+	ret = linkSetup(imguName_, PAD_VF, viewfinderName, 0, enable);
+	if (ret) {
+		mediaDevice_->close();
+		return ret;
+	}
+
+	ret = linkSetup(imguName_, PAD_STAT, statName, 0, enable);
+	if (ret) {
+		mediaDevice_->close();
+		return ret;
+	}
+
+	mediaDevice_->close();
+
+	return 0;
+}
+
 int PipelineHandlerIPU3::mediaBusToCIO2Format(unsigned int code)
 {
 	switch (code) {
